It has been brought to my attention that this lens is having trouble autofocusing in the A1 servo mode when used on a Canon 7D camera.

I have this lens on backorder for use on that camera, the 7D. I mainly would use this lens for birds in flight, and other wildlife photos. I normally shoot in the A1 servo mode so naturally I am concerned any AF problems.

My question is, has anyone had any issues with this lens? I would appreciate any information. I have spoken with an Adorama tech and he tells me he has heard nothing. When asked how many returns of this lens they had received he referred me to their service department, go figure. I am seriously considering canceling this order right now. Any thoughts?

Chris,

You are welcome but actually we need to thank MT Shooter though. He brought this to my attention in this thread.

http://www.uglyhedgehog.com/t-196384-1.html#3332920

He posted these links, shown below, for me to review.

"The issues are widespread, but seem to be primarily with the 7D and 1D bodies, although some have had the same issue with the 5D3 also:
http://www.fredmiranda.com/forum/topic/1278436

http://www.photographyblog.com/reviews/tamron_sp_150_600mm_f5_6_3_di_vc_usd_review/commen...

http://www.the-digital-picture.com/Reviews/Tamron-150-600mm-f-5-6.3-Di-VC-USD-Lens.aspx
(Note: go to the "Focusing" section on the site above)

http://www.fredmiranda.com/forum/topic/1278336/0

Reports of these issues have been popping up all over the place, and Tamrons inventory disappeared off shelves almost as soon as the issue was revealed. Now the Nikon and Sony mount releases have been pushed back. Some Canon mounts have again become available in the last couple weeks, but on a VERY limited basis."

After reviewing these I got on the phone with Adorama but the "expert" I chatted with was very reluctant to tell me anything! When I asked if they had gotten any returns he referred me to their service department. This brought up a BIG RED flag, which brought on this thread!
